First month here and it's a wonderful place

I've lived here almost one month now and am really enjoying it. For one thing it's my first apartment without a roommate, but I also feel that the building and staff are very good. A few other reviews have mentioned that this high rise is older than others in the downtown Bethesda area which is true, but it also seems to be well-built and is taken care of.
I've heard a little bit of noise from next door neighbors once or twice late on a weeknight, but it didn't last long so there have been no problems there. Other neighbors that I've met have been very friendly. Management, front desk staff and maintenance have also been very friendly and accommodating. I had a rough time moving in as it was mostly just me moving large objects like a queen size bed, and they were kind enough to watch my pickup truck out front while I did paperwork in the office, helped me out using the freight elevator and things like that. It was unexpected and I was very pleasantly surprised.
The units all have wood parquet floors, though Montgomery County requires that most of it be carpeted. Still, it's a very nice thing to have, in addition to having a nice balcony. Hot water in the kitchen and bathroom comes out of the tap immediately, and the fridge/freezer is nice. They also replaced the very old counter tops and bathroom medicine cabinet/mirror prior to my moving in. Kitchen cabinetry is pretty old and outdated, but it's not something that bothers me as it's still solid and works just fine. I put down some nice silicon shelf liner sheets and all is good.
The building also has a rooftop pool, though I've yet to go check it out. Looks nice enough from aerial photos on GoogleMaps.
There is an underground parking garage in the building, though I'm told there is a waiting list to get a spot there. I may eventually do this, but for now using the public garage directly across the street (you buy monthly permits from a nearby public parking county office) has been just fine for me. I have no word, yet, on break-ins or any other issues there, though I'm always careful to not leave anything of interest or value within sight in my car when I lock it up anyway.
Washing machines and dryers are available in small wash rooms on each floor, and I was lucky enough to get a place right next to one. I hear no noise from the machines through the walls. I've only put in a minor maintenance request so far which was taken care of during the same day -- I came home from work and it was done, so zero complaints there.
Overall, I highly recommend 8200 Wisconsin Ave. Staff here are excellent, location is great (10 to 12 minute walk to Bethesda metro station, passing lots of shops and restaurants on the way, very easy access to 355), and the price is affordable compared to other high rise apartments just a couple of blocks away. Again, the building is older compared to those other high rises, but unless you're put off by not having the very newest facilities (which you'd be paying for) in every aspect of the building, then I recommend checking this place out. Note that vacancies don't come up often here and when they do they are quickly filled, so check places like Craigslist often, or just call the office here often and ask and they can tell you if something is available or if there will be something soon as they require a lengthy 60-day notice to vacate. The only reason that policy doesn't cause me any concern is that it wouldn't be difficult to find someone to sublet my lease if I should have to leave at short notice.
